The UI Stead Family Department of Pediatrics is seeking a Program Coordinator. The position will coordinate administrative, operational, and fiscal responsibilities requiring a high degree of discretion, leadership, and independent judgment in the Divisions of Pediatric Nephrology, Rheumatology, Developmental Behavioral Pediatrics, and Psychology. This position will manage multiple programs to improve the delivery of clinical services under the general direction of the Departmental Administration and the respective Division Directors. The Stead Family Department of Pediatrics is a national leader in pediatric medicine. The Department's mission is to provide outstanding care to the children of Iowa and beyond by being a leader in state-of-the-art clinical care to children, performing cutting-edge research to find new treatments and cures for childhood illnesses and educating the next generation of pediatric health care providers. The Department comprises the medical and research staff of UI Stead Family Children’s Hospital. UI Stead Family Children’s Hospital is one of the nation’s top-ranked pediatric care and research institutions, and Iowa’s only comprehensive children’s hospital.
